web-dev-qa-db-fra.com

Echec de la synchronisation Gradle, NDK non configuré, téléchargez-le avec le gestionnaire de SDK.

Je suis complètement nouveau dans le développement Android et viens d'installer Android Studio. Je fais un exercice HelloGL2 très basique et j’ai ouvert le fichier HelloGL2.iml. J'ai essayé de l'exécuter, mais il est indiqué que la synchronisation du projet Gradle a échoué et que le NDK n'est pas configuré. En termes simples (pour un débutant complet dans Android), comment puis-je résoudre ce problème?

12
Karina H

Vous pouvez installer ces composants à l'aide du SDK Manager:

From an open project, select Tools > Android > SDK Manager from the main menu.
Click the SDK Tools tab.
Check the box next to NDK
Click apply

Voir guide pour plus de détails

23
Umair

// Essayez celui-ci 1 - Android Studio -> Outils -> Gestionnaire de SDK -> sélectionnez Outils SDK 

2 - Cochez les cases à côté de LLDB, CMake et NDK 

3 - Appliquer et appuyer sur le bouton OK ..  enter image description here

4
Ijas Aslam

avec Android studio 3.0 +, ce problème est abordé différemment. 

Allez dans Fichier> Paramètres> SDK Android> et sélectionnez l'entrée SDK et mettez-le à jour. Cela devrait régler le problème. 

l'autre approche du même problème est que lorsque vous effectuez une synchronisation de projet Gradle, elle identifie automatiquement le problème de mise à niveau de la version et vous fournit un lien cliquable dans la console. Au cours de ces étapes, il peut également vous inviter à mettre à jour d’autres dépendances, telles que CMake.

2
Gautam

si vous voyez cette erreur, il se peut que vous n'ayez plus de NDK dans votre SDK.

vous feriez donc mieux de le télécharger depuis ici et de copier tous les dossiers et fichiers de votre SDK.

aussi vous pouvez aller; ouvrir un projet> sélectionner des outils [dans la page supérieure]> Android> Gestionnaire de SDK [du menu principal]> cliquer sur l'onglet Outils de SDK> et cocher la case en regard de NDK

si vous n'avez pas NDK dans l'onglet Outils du SDK, vous pouvez télécharger automatiquement dans ce dossier

2
A.Bahrami

Ma version est un peu différente:

Depuis un projet ouvert, sélectionnez Outils> Android> Gestionnaire de SDK dans le menu principal. Dans Apparence et comportement> Paramètres système> SDK Android, je dois cliquer sur l'onglet Outils du SDK. Cochez la case en regard de NDK Cliquez sur appliquer

0